What Is the Cost of Living Near Tampa?

Understanding the cost of living near Tampa is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at The Room Marketing.
Tampa's Cost of Living Index is approximately 100.1 (0.1% more expensive than US average; 2.9% less than FL average). Growing Gulf Coast city, housing costs near US average but have risen. HART bus/streetcar. When planning your budget based on a salary from The Room Marketing,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,400 - $2,100+ A significant portion of The Room Marketing sal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$160 - $260 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$65 (HART mon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$400 - $590 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$380 - $700+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$690+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,775 - $4,345+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
